Hi! First time BP owner. Loving my little buddy so much. The breeder had him eating a small rat every 2 weeks. I have weighed him each month since I got him and he went from 815 grams in middle of March of this year to 1001 grams today! Shocking because I assumed he was basically full grown since he's 4 years old. Is this normal growth for his age? Would you guys stretch the feedings to every 3 weeks maybe? I just don't want him to get obese!! Any info appreciated
